Deadly Hands of K'un-Lun #1 - A War God Rises and Iron Fist’s Legacy Shatters

The martial arts corner of the Marvel Universe has been set ablaze with the release of Deadly Hands of K’un-Lun #1 (2026). This issue marks a seismic shift in the Iron Fist mythos, blending familial betrayal, ancient mythological gods, and a desperate struggle for a legacy that feels heavier than ever.

A Legacy Fractured: The Lin Brothers

The story begins with a dive into the past of the Lin brothers. We learn that Lin Lie (the current Iron Fist) grew up in the shadow of his brilliant older brother, Lin Feng. While Lie was content fixing broken artifacts—which he called his “puzzles”—Feng was a charismatic leader who craved attention and excellence.

Their lives changed forever when their archaeologist father discovered that Chiyou, the ancient God of War, was real. The Lin family was tasked with being Chiyou’s Tomb Keepers, a duty tied to the Sword of Fu Xi. However, Feng eventually sided with Chiyou to end this centuries-long burden. In the ensuing chaos, the Sword of Fu Xi was shattered, and its shards became embedded in Lin Lie’s hands, granting him power but causing immense, constant pain.

The Conqueror in K’un-Lun

In the present, Lin Feng has seized control of K’un-Lun. Alongside the Steel Serpent (Davos) and the Bride of Nine Spiders, Feng is systematically dismantling the Seven Heavenly Cities.

The stakes are raised when Loki, the God of Stories, makes an appearance. Feng is hunting for the Soul Orbs of Chiyou to resurrect the war god fully. While Feng has secured some orbs, Loki warns him that the final orb is in K’un-Lun and that Chiyou’s whispers are dangerous. Feng, unfazed, sets his sights on expansion, even questioning Loki about the whereabouts of Thor.

Life in New York: The Burden of the Fist

Back on Earth, Lin Lie is struggling to adjust to his role as the Iron Fist. He resides in a New York underground lab with Uncle Fooh, an exiled inventor, and Pei, a former Iron Fist and current high schooler. The dynamic is tense; Pei is frustrated that the “Junior” (Lie) took her title, while Lie suffers from “imposter syndrome,” feeling he can never live up to the legacy of the original Iron Fist, Danny Rand.

A lighthearted attempt at a date with White Fox (Ami Han) at a California aquarium goes sideways when a monster attack causes significant damage. After being scolded by Fooh for using “finicky technology” for personal trips, Lie is sent to Hell’s Kitchen to investigate a dark anomaly.

The Shadow of the War God

In Hell’s Kitchen, Lie teams up with Daredevil (Elektra Natchios) and White Tiger (Ava Ayala) to face a shadowy, speed-based threat. The antagonist, a “shadow” cast by Lin Feng, reveals a horrifying truth: Feng’s forces have been slaughtering the Immortal Weapons of the other Heavenly Cities. The villain taunts Lie, claiming they ripped Fat Cobra to pieces and drowned the Prince of Orphans.

As Lie reels from this news, the scene shifts back to K’un-Lun. Feng has gathered his army, including Davos and Neon Dragon, preparing for a full-scale teleportation to Earth.

The issue concludes with a haunting transition. As Pei looks at a diorama of K’un-Lun, she realizes “something horrible is coming”. Lin Feng and his army arrive in New York, accompanied by a traditional war song of K’un-Lun—a song usually sung for the Iron Fist, but now repurposed for a path of no return.
